Rhino C++ API  8.14
ON_Quaternion Member List

This is the complete list of members for ON_Quaternion, including all inherited members.

aON_Quaternion
bON_Quaternion
cON_Quaternion
Conjugate() constON_Quaternion
dON_Quaternion
Distance(const ON_Quaternion &p, const ON_Quaternion &q)ON_Quaternionstatic
DistanceTo(const ON_Quaternion &q) constON_Quaternion
Exp(ON_Quaternion q)ON_Quaternionstatic
GetEulerZYZ(double &alpha, double &beta, double &gamma) constON_Quaternion
GetRotation(double &angle, ON_3dVector &axis) constON_Quaternion
GetRotation(ON_Xform &xform) constON_Quaternion
GetRotation(ON_Plane &plane) constON_Quaternion
GetYawPitchRoll(double &yaw, double &pitch, double &roll) constON_Quaternion
ION_Quaternionstatic
IdentityON_Quaternionstatic
Inverse() constON_Quaternion
Invert()ON_Quaternion
IsNotZero() constON_Quaternion
IsScalar() constON_Quaternion
IsValid() constON_Quaternion
IsVector() constON_Quaternion
IsZero() constON_Quaternion
JON_Quaternionstatic
KON_Quaternionstatic
Length() constON_Quaternion
LengthSquared() constON_Quaternion
Log(ON_Quaternion q)ON_Quaternionstatic
MatrixForm() constON_Quaternion
ON_Quaternion()ON_Quaternioninline
ON_Quaternion(double qa, double qb, double qc, double qd)ON_Quaternion
ON_Quaternion(const ON_3dVector &v)ON_Quaternion
operator*(int) constON_Quaternion
operator*(float) constON_Quaternion
operator*(double) constON_Quaternion
operator*(const ON_Quaternion &) constON_Quaternion
operator+(const ON_Quaternion &) constON_Quaternion
operator-(const ON_Quaternion &) constON_Quaternion
operator/(int) constON_Quaternion
operator/(float) constON_Quaternion
operator/(double) constON_Quaternion
operator=(const ON_3dVector &v)ON_Quaternion
Pow(ON_Quaternion q, double t)ON_Quaternionstatic
Rotate(ON_3dVector v) constON_Quaternion
RotateTowards(ON_Quaternion q0, ON_Quaternion q1, double MaxRadians)ON_Quaternionstatic
Rotation(double angle, const ON_3dVector &axis)ON_Quaternionstatic
Rotation(const ON_Plane &plane0, const ON_Plane &plane1)ON_Quaternionstatic
RotationZYX(double yaw, double pitch, double roll)ON_Quaternionstatic
RotationZYZ(double alpha, double beta, double gamma)ON_Quaternionstatic
Scalar() constON_Quaternion
Set(double qa, double qb, double qc, double qd)ON_Quaternion
SetRotation(double angle, const ON_3dVector &axis)ON_Quaternion
SetRotation(const ON_Plane &plane0, const ON_Plane &plane1)ON_Quaternion
Slerp(ON_Quaternion q0, ON_Quaternion q1, double t)ON_Quaternionstatic
Unitize()ON_Quaternion
Vector() constON_Quaternion
ZeroON_Quaternionstatic